<h3>Genetic markers</h3>
A molecular genetic marker is a fragment of DNA that can be used to trace the inheritance pattern from parents to offspring.
In this case, parents and offspring exhibit three molecular markers which are shared among them.
There are certain genetic markers that are present in the offspring but they are absent in one of the parents, and therefore they can be used to trace the inheritance pattern.
